Transaction 57ac7012209b46b0cd52dc7ab4ccd8efd8adb36c44bcbfae6b64e90219cdc460

1 Input
2 Outputs
  • 57ac7012209b46b0cd52dc7ab4ccd8efd8adb36c44bcbfae6b64e90219cdc460:0
  • value  58504882
    address  3KPpL25ghHrkCLc5KxV23f3nhCdFWfrh5m
  • 57ac7012209b46b0cd52dc7ab4ccd8efd8adb36c44bcbfae6b64e90219cdc460:1
  • value  23500000
    address  16EfFrScTAvbho8iABTVHw8pVwcenhPhg9